The PhD program of Princeton Theological Seminary forms scholars, servants, and leaders of the church and the academy through constructive, critical engagement with the Christian tradition in its complexity and diversity and, where appropriate, in conversation with other religious and intellectual traditions in their multiplicity and variety.
